Parentheses within Parentheses ( ) - Elite Editing For example, you have a parenthetical element, such as an in-text reference (e.g., Elite Editing, 2014). Now, you want to add an additional parenthetical element, such as an abbreviation (EE), into the parentheses. Keeping them as they are (identically curved), can lead to confusion about where the elements start and stop. The following punctuation marks should be used sparingly, as they are more specialized than those that appear above. DASHES. Use a dash to draw attention to parenthetical information, to prepare for changes in tone, or to introduce or emphasize information.

Using paranthesis in essay - Write my essay help How to Use Parentheses - firstediting.com Punctuation varies according to use, since both incomplete and complete sentences can reside happily within parentheses. If the sentence starts with an opening parenthesis, or the parentheses surround a complete sentence, an editor will put the terminal punctuation mark—the period, question mark, or exclamation point—inside the closing ...
